The delightful seaside town of Lyme Regis has much to offer its visitors, boasting a maze of narrow streets filled with craft and antique shops, galleries and cafes. Take a stroll along the world-famous Cobb causeway overlooking the ancient harbour, where fishing trips can be enjoyed, or try your hand at fossil hunting in the area. The scenic coastal path offers excellent walking opportunities and spectacular views of the stunning Jurassic coast, whilst the gently shelving sands and sparkling waters of Lyme Bay provide the perfect place in which to relax and unwind. Accommodation

Duplex apartment set over ground and first floor.

Two bedrooms: 1 x ground-floor double with en-suite shower-room with walk-in shower, basin and WC, 1 x first-floor twin.

First-floor bathroom with bath, shower over, basin and WC.

Kitchen.

Dining room with snug.

Sitting room with open fire

Gas heating with open fire.

Electric oven, electric hob, microwave, fridge with ice box, washing machine, dishwasher.

Fuel and power included in rent.

Bed linen and towels included in rent.

Off-road parking for 1 car.

Enclosed garden with raised decking, steps leading to lawn and furniture.

Pet-friendly, sorry no smoking.

Shop 0.3 miles, pub 0.3 miles.

Note: Maximum of 1 dog accepted
